For those looking to purchase tickets, it's important to note that Upton (Merseyside) station doesn't have a ticket office or ticket machines. You will need to purchase your tickets online or at an alternative station if you prefer collecting them in-person. The station is equipped with an induction loop to assist individuals with hearing impairments, which can be valuable for receiving station announcements.
Step-free access is available, but with limitations. Platform 1 has a ramp with steps that are not suitable for wheelchairs, while Platform 2 can be accessed via a steep gradient with handrails. For those needing assistance, the Passenger Assist service is available if booked in advance. While there are no staffed help points or seating in waiting rooms, there is a seating area available.
Other facilities such as toilets, refreshment options, and bike storage are not available, so it's best to plan accordingly. If you rely on Wi-Fi or need to use a payphone, you'll have to look for those services elsewhere, as they are not provided. For lost property inquiries, you can contact Transport for Wales.

Located in the charming village of Roydon, Essex, Roydon train station serves as a quiet gateway to the bustling cityscape of London and the serene landscapes of surrounding towns. The station is managed by Greater Anglia and is a part of its West Anglia Main Line service. Serving a mix of commuters and leisure travelers, it blends the rural allure with modern convenience, ensuring a hassle-free experience for all passengers.
While Roydon station lacks a ticket office, it compensates with the presence of ticket machines that are available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. With accessibility in mind, these machines are easily reachable for passengers with disabilities. The station features smartcard validators, which add to the convenience for tech-savvy travelers who prefer a digital mode of travel.
Despite its quaint size, Roydon station prioritizes passenger assistance with the availability of a help point staffed around the clock, ensuring that no query goes unresolved. However, passengers are advised that the station lacks luggage storage and lost property facilities, so plan accordingly.
Traveling to and from Roydon is seamless with several local bus services providing connectivity to the surrounding regions. The station is not served by a rail replacement service, but taxis can be easily accessed for a more personalized journey. For cyclists, the station offers a convenient bicycle storage solution situated on platform 1, although there's no cycle hire available on-site.
Accessibility is embraced at Roydon station with step-free access available to both platforms via a level crossing on High Street, enhancing ease for passengers with reduced mobility. The station is classified as a B1 station, indicating that while most areas are accessible, some support could still be needed. Passengers can benefit from the presence of an induction loop and accessible ticket machines. However, no ramps are available for train access, so prior arrangements for assistance are recommended.
